Robyn Frye, Vice President at Workday join’s Ann on this week's episode of Afternoon Cyber Tea. Robin has spent the last 20 years working in security and compliance consulting and is currently the Vice President of Cybersecurity Governance, Risk, and Compliance at Workday. Robyn shares her background, growing up in Silicon Valley and her journey into cybersecurity. The conversation touches on the significance of mentorship and sponsorship in career growth, with Robyn providing practical advice on how individuals can seek out mentors and sponsors to support their professional development. Ann and Robyn provide insights into the current landscape of cybersecurity and offer actionable strategies for promoting diversity, inclusion, and talent development within organizations.

Ann Johnson, Corporate Vice President, Business Development, Security, Compliance & Identity at Microsoft, talks with cybersecurity thought leaders and influential industry experts about the trends shaping the cyber landscape and what should be top-of-mind for the C-suite and other key decision makers. Ann and her guests explore the risk and promise of tools and systems powered by AI, IoT, machine learning, and other emerging technology, as well as the impact on how humans work, communicate, consume information, and live in this era of digital transformation.
